MARK 8:34-37 “When He had called the people to Himself, with His disciples also, He said to them, “Whoever desires to come after Me, let him deny himself, and take up his cross, and follow Me.” 35-For whoever desires to save his life will lose it, but whoever loses his life for My sake and the gospel’s will save it. 36-For what will it profit a man if he gains the whole world, and loses his own soul? 37-Or what will a man give in exchange for his soul?

There are three commandments in Mark 8:34 that lead up to 2 of JESUS’ questions at the end. 
If we keep them we will save our souls. Otherwise, we will forfeit our souls and eternal life.

1. JESUS said, “Whoever DESIRES to come after me...” JESUS doesn't mean that this desire is optional —it's ok or it’s not okay to desire Him. Rather, this desire is essential to saving a man’s soul. And the desire to follow Him must be consuming —not half-hearted or lukewarm.

Life on this earth comes with challenges, obstacles and difficulties, and GOD knows it.
Man relentlessly pursues the world, but only a few desire the LORD first in their life. Do you truly pursue CHRIST daily?

2. JESUS says, “DENY yourself and TAKE UP YOUR CROSS...” 
This desire must translate into dedication. This doesn't mean you have to give up the things that are normal and needful in this life, such as education, career, material possessions, food and healthful activities, rest and recreation, caring for others. But these things must be secondary. GOD knows we need them. But they must conform to JESUS’ desire for you, not a “me first” desire..

To deny self is to be consistent and constant in our dedication to CHRIST. -How consistent are you in your devotion to JESUS? 

3. JESUS says, “FOLLOW ME”
This commandment gives direction to our desire to follow JESUS’ life example. It means reflecting the life and love of CHRIST to a desperate world around you. -Not every disciple can be a leader, but we all must be followers of JESUS CHRIST. To follow His example is not easy. There are lots of obstacles and opposition along the way. But His Word reminds us, “I can do all things through CHRIST who gives me strength”….and “Greater is He who is in me than he that is in this world.” It profits us nothing to follow the world. So, although the journey is difficult, let us follow JESUS. And remember what He said, “Narrow is the gate and difficult is the way which leads to life, and there are few who find it” (Matthew 7:13-14). But JESUS also says, “I will never leave you nor forsake you.”
